Discover air styling's newest breakthrough. designed with high-performance heat and ceramic attachments, the aire 360 air styler blowout kit styles bouncy blowouts and lasting curls with nothing but air. powered by T3 aire 360 technology, superior airflow wraps hair effortlessly to style blowout curls with zero heat damage, and extra-long ceramic curling attachments harness high-performance heat to deliver long-lasting results. The custom-designed oval brush features smoothGrip bristles and a ceramic surface for pro-level smoothing and shaping. and the softAire drying concentrator delivers fast-yet-gentle drying that helps protect hair's natural moisture. all attachments pair with the aire 360 base, engineered with a smart microchip for digital heat control and a high-speed aireX motor for our fastest drying yet. fast, easy styling that's gentle on hair. big-time body and shine. blowout curls that defy gravity. based on a third-party study in which a tensile strength test showed no mechanical damage to the hair when using the T3 aire 360 curling attachments set on the highest temperature and highest velocity on hair in both a dry state and a 20% wet state.

Tricky to figure out but great if you do!

I love the T3 Aire and would definitely recommend with a few caveats. For context, I have fine, sparse, straight Asian hair that's really difficult to hold a curl. Even with regular curling irons, I need much higher temp than what's recommended in order to sustain a curl. Similarly, with overnight curls I can get them to work but they won't really last the day. That said, while curls are possible with the T3, it took a lot of work finding out how to make them work. What I've discovered is that the only way that I can hold the curls using the T3 is if I 1) use as little of the necessary hair products as possible (heat protectant, texturizing spray, and hairspray), 2) my hair is about 60-70% wet when I start curling, 3) I use the highest heat setting, and 4) I immediately put my hair in rollers in order to create tension while the curls set. Otherwise, my hair goes flat in 10 minutes. Even with all 4 steps, the curls still loosen within the first hour, but whatever form they take after the first hour is how they'll hold for the rest of the day. In the end, it really does look more like a blowout than curl-curls, which is what I've heard that people say about these kinds of devices. Using the T3 is definitely not as easy breezy as I've seen many people online make it look. But it's definitely less involved and much easier/preferable (in my opinion) than using a curling iron/straightener/overnight curls. Plus, even at the highest heat settings, the temp is much lower than the lowest setting on a curler, so it's still better for my hair, and I do think the curls look really nice if you can figure out how to make them stick. With regards to the T3 in comparison to the Dyson Airwrap, I think it depends on your hair type and what you're looking for. This definitely has much less heads than the Airwrap, but I personally found the T3 to have all that I need, and I'd actually recommend it over the Airwrap for anyone with fine hair like mine. The brush head on the T3 has a mix of regular and small boar brush-like bristles that grip your hair, making it easier to brush and style. With the Airwrap, I found that all the brush heads did not have tightly-spaced bristles like this, so all my hair would fly away as soon as I turned the air on, even at the lowest setting. Therefore the only useful brushes were the curling and the smoothing/drying one, which the T3 has. Even though you need to change the curling heads on the T3, I actually find it helpful because they have arrows, so I know which direction to pick when curling my hair. I'm not really switching back and forth constantly, so it's not an issue for me at all. I'd definitely recommend, but only to those who are willing to take the time to figure out how to make it work for your hair type and texture.
